PROF SAMPSON ANTWI BSc, MB ChB, Dip PDM ( (Liverpool), MPhil (Cape Town), FWACP, FGCP, Cert Nephrol (CMSA), IPNA Fellow
I am a Professor of Child Health and Paediatric Nephrology at Kwame Nkrumah University of Science and Technology and a Consultant Paediatric Nephrologist at the Komfo Anokye Teaching Hospital, Kumasi-Ghana.
My clinical expertise is in three (3) areas: 1) Paediatric nephrology 2) Paediatric HIV 3) Nutrition and Malnutritional disorders in children
I established the paediatric nephrology unit, the pediatric HIV clinic and the malnutrition unit in my institution.
In terms of service, I have established comprehensive acute peritoneal dialysis programme in Ghana since 2012 and have carried out nationwide training of district doctors (non-nephrologists) in the performance of acute peritoneal dialysis in emergencies. To date, my center has performed over 300 peritoneal dialysis for AKI with close to 70% survival rate.
I have been involved in various capacities in several research into malaria, kidney diseases, HIV & TB, and childhood malnutrition.
I to the first ever ISPD guidelines for peritoneal dialysis in acute kidney injury: 2020 Update (paediatrics).
I am a member of the H3Africa Research Consortium.
Currently, I am the Kumasi site Principal Investigator for the Amplitude Clinical Trial of Inaxaplin on APOL 1-mediated Proteinuric Kidney Disease in Adults and Paediatrics.
